TAKEN ON TRUST
Terry Waite
Hodder & Stoughton Fourth impression 1993
370 pages
h/c with d/j - approx 24cm x 16cm - no inscriptions - photographs - d/j price-clipped
from d/j:
In his prison cell Terry Waite wrote his autobiography in his head. This is it, his own heart-rending account of how he survived for 1,763 days in captivity, almost four years of which were in solitary confinement. He reveals the inner strengths which helped him endure the savage treatment he received from his captors; he tells of his constant struggle to maintain his faith and of his resolve not to have any regrets, any false sentimentality or self-pity. Above all it was his recollection of times past, of his life from childhood onwards which gave him the will to keep going...
A humanitarian in his own right, he became a negotiator over the plight of hostages in Tehran and Libya - he describes his meetings with Colonel Gaddafi - and finally with the kidnappers of the Beirut hostages. He charts his ever-increasing involvement with those on all sides, including Oliver North and George Bush, until that fateful day in January 1987 when he himself became a captive...
